Pimpri Chinchwad Science Park Announces Summer Camp & Workshops 2026
Pimpri : The Pimpri Chinchwad Science Park has announced an extensive series of summer camps and science workshops for students from Grade 2 to 12, scheduled during April and May 2026.
Focused on hands-on learning, the initiative aims to foster curiosity, creativity, and a scientific mindset among students. The programs will cover a wide range of subjects including robotics, astronomy, drone technology, mathematics, chemistry, and Arduino-based systems, offering practical learning experiences.
Key highlights include STEM and robotics programs with take-home models, telescope-based sky observation sessions, drone flying demonstrations, and creative math and chemistry workshops. Special Arduino training sessions and science model-making activities are also part of the curriculum.
A unique family-oriented event, “Science Sparkle,” will feature interactive exhibits and engaging science experiences.
Additionally, in collaboration with Leadership for Equity, the “RoadToCode Summer Camp” for students of Grades 3 to 10 will focus on artificial intelligence, coding, 3D printing, and physical computing. The camp begins on April 15, 2026, with fortnightly batches.
